Education is not limited to books and exams. It is understanding, which is different for different minds. It is about creating the proper environment for each student or learner to blossom.
Education means having habits that make the learning process and mental health better, which drives students, teachers, and even families to better cope with the academy without stress and fatigue. Studies show that many teachers undergo burnout in an attempt to address the various needs of every student. The new tools, such as AI, may deliver lessons tailored to each learner’s needs and abilities, but their understanding of student progress remains limited.
A good learning environment can immensely affect a student’s confidence and help grow self-esteem. Relentless pressure, comparison with other students, and putting unrealistic expectations and a lack of support can eventually lead to elevated stress levels, not just in children but also in all the people who are trying to keep up. Children with ADHD and other neurodivergent conditions may experience studying a bit differently than others; still, numerous education style still face issues in creating a system to help support the differences.
Education in today’s world has become very demanding, and success is often measured solely by the percentage of marks obtained and not overall growth. It is important to understand that behind every academic performance, many students are facing difficulties in managing their emotional well-being
